Diving into the Mechanics of Automatic Cleaning

At their core, automatic hoovers are created to navigate your home autonomously and clean floorings without direct human control. They achieve this through a combination of advanced technologies, consisting of sensors, navigation systems, and cleaning systems.

The majority of automatic hoovers run on rechargeable batteries and come with a charging dock. When their battery is low, or after completing a cleaning cycle, they automatically return to their dock to recharge. The cleaning process itself typically includes:

  • Navigation: This is probably the most essential element. Automatic hoovers utilize different navigation techniques to map and traverse your living area. Early models frequently utilized bump-and-go navigation, arbitrarily bouncing around up until they covered an area. However, contemporary models utilize advanced systems like:

    • SLAM (Simultaneous Localization and Mapping): This innovation allows the robot to develop a map of its surroundings in real-time while at the same time determining its location within that map.
    • L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ging): LiDAR uses laser beams to measure distances and create extremely accurate maps, making it possible for efficient and systematic cleaning patterns.
    • VSLAM (Visual Simultaneous Localization and Mapping): Similar to SLAM however counts on cams rather of lasers to perceive and map the environment.
    • Gyroscope and Odometry: Some designs combine gyroscopes and wheel sensing units (odometry) to track motion and direction, improving navigation.
  • Sensors: A plethora of sensing units are integrated to help the robot hoover interact safely and efficiently with its environment. These frequently consist of:

    • Cliff sensing units: Prevent the robot from dropping stairs or ledges.
    • Challenge sensing units: Detect barriers like furniture, walls, and pet bowls, allowing the robot to browse around them.
    • Wall sensors: Enable the robot to follow walls and edges for comprehensive edge cleaning.
    • Dirt detection sensing units: In some advanced designs, these sensors can find areas with higher concentrations of dirt and particles, triggering more concentrated cleaning.
  • Cleaning Mechanisms: Automatic hoovers usually use a combination of:

    • Rotating brushes: These brushes sweep dirt and debris from the floor towards the suction inlet. They frequently come in different styles for numerous floor types.
    • Side brushes: Extend the cleaning reach to edges and corners.
    • Suction: Generates airflow to raise dirt and dust into the dustbin. Suction power differs between designs.
    • Mopping pads: Some hybrid designs integrate mopping performance, using wet pads to gently mop difficult floors after or during vacuuming.

Kinds Of Automatic Hoovers: From Basic to Feature-Rich

The market for automatic hoovers varies, accommodating a wide variety of needs and budget plans. They can be broadly categorized based upon their features and functionalities:

  • Basic Models: These are typically entry-level robots focusing on fundamental cleaning. They typically use bump-and-go navigation or simpler gyroscope-based navigation. They are typically more budget friendly however might lack sophisticated features like mapping, app control, or strong suction.

  • Mid-Range Models: Offering a balance in between cost and functions, these designs frequently integrate smart navigation (SLAM, LiDAR, or VSLAM), app connection, and scheduling capabilities. They typically supply more efficient cleaning patterns and much better obstacle avoidance than fundamental designs.

  • High-End Models: These are the superior offerings, loaded with innovative technologies and features. They typically boast exceptional navigation, mapping capabilities, multi-floor mapping (remembering maps for different levels of your home), personalized cleaning zones, "no-go" zones (locations you wish to prevent cleaning), self-emptying dustbins, and combination with smart home environments.

  • Hybrid Vacuum-Mop Models: These versatile robotics combine vacuuming and mopping performances in one gadget. They can vacuum up dry debris and after that mop tough floors with a wet pad, offering a two-in-one cleaning solution.

  • Specialized Models: Certain automatic hoovers are developed with specific needs in mind, such as designs optimized for pet hair elimination with powerful suction and tangle-free brushes, or designs developed for homes with carpets, including carpet increase innovation to increase suction power on carpeted surface areas.

The Benefits of Embracing Automatic Cleaning

The popularity of automatic hoovers comes from the numerous advantages they offer:

  • Convenience and Time-Saving: The most considerable advantage is undoubtedly the hands-free cleaning experience. You can set them to clean while you are at work, running errands, or just unwinding, releasing up important time.
  • Consistent Cleaning: Automatic hoovers can be scheduled to clean frequently, making sure consistent floor cleanliness and minimizing the buildup of dust and irritants.
  • Accessibility: For senior people or those with movement concerns, automatic hoovers can offer a vital aid in maintaining a clean home without physical strain.
  • Pet Hair Management: Automatic hoovers, especially designs designed for pet owners, are effective at capturing pet hair, dander, and allergens, contributing to a much healthier home environment.
  • Improved Air Quality: By routinely removing dust and allergens, automatic hoovers can add to much better indoor air quality, especially useful for people with allergies or breathing level of sensitivities.
  • Reaching Under Furniture: Their low profile allows them to clean up under beds, sofas, and other furniture where conventional vacuums frequently struggle to reach.

Choosing the Right Automatic Hoover for Your Home

Choosing the ideal automatic hoover depends upon individual needs and home attributes. Consider these factors when making your choice:

  • Floor Types: Determine the main floor types in your home (hardwood, carpet, tile, and so on). Some models are much better suited for specific floor types. Inspect if the design is created for carpets if you have substantial carpeted areas.
  • Home Size and Layout: Larger homes might benefit from designs with longer battery life and advanced mapping abilities for effective cleaning. Complex designs with multiple spaces and obstacles may require robotics with exceptional navigation.
  • Budget: Automatic hoovers vary considerably in price. Develop a spending plan and check out designs within your cost variety that provide the features you require.
  • Functions: Prioritize features based on your needs. Think about:
    • Navigation System: SLAM, LiDAR, VSLAM for efficient and systematic cleaning.
    • App Control and Smart Features: Scheduling, zone cleaning, no-go zones, smart home combination.
    • Suction Power: Higher suction for pet hair and carpets.
    • Battery Life: Longer run time for bigger homes.
    • Self-Emptying Dustbin: For added benefit and less frequent upkeep.
    • Mopping Functionality: If you desire to mop difficult floors also.
    • Sound Level: Consider designs with lower sound levels if noise sensitivity is an issue.

Preserving Your Automatic Hoover

To guarantee optimum performance and durability, regular upkeep is important:

  • Empty the Dustbin Regularly: Frequent emptying prevents the dustbin from overfilling and maintains suction effectiveness. Self-emptying models lower this job considerably.
  • Clean Brushes and Filters: Hair and debris can build up on brushes and filters, minimizing cleaning effectiveness. Clean them routinely as per the manufacturer's directions.
  • Examine Sensors: Ensure sensors are tidy and free from dust or blockages for correct navigation.
  • Replace Parts as Needed: Brushes and filters will ultimately require replacement. Follow the maker's suggestions for replacement periods.
  • Battery Care: While generally long-lasting, batteries have a life-span. Follow charging instructions and avoid leaving the robot vacuum cleaner best continually on the charger once completely charged to maximize battery health.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) about Automatic Hoovers

Q1: Are automatic hoovers as effective as traditional vacuum cleaners?A: While suction power has actually substantially enhanced in recent models, a lot of automatic hoovers may not match the deep cleaning power of a high-end traditional upright or canister vacuum, particularly for heavily soiled areas or thick carpets. However, for daily cleaning and maintenance, they are generally very efficient.

Q2: Can automatic hoovers clean all types of floorings?A: Many automatic hoovers are developed to work well on various floor types, consisting of hardwood, tile, laminate, and low-pile carpets. However, some designs are much better suited for specific floor types. Inspect item specifications to guarantee compatibility with your floor covering.

Q3: How long do automatic hoover batteries last?A: Battery life varies depending upon the design and cleaning mode. The majority of models offer in between 60 to 120 minutes of run time on a single charge. Higher-end designs may provide even longer battery life.

Q4: Are automatic hoovers noisy?A: Noise levels differ amongst models. Normally, they are quieter than traditional vacuum cleaners, but some noise is still produced. Consider models with lower decibel scores if noise level of sensitivity is a concern.

Q5: Do automatic hoovers require a lot of upkeep?A: Routine upkeep is essential, including emptying the dustbin, cleaning brushes and filters, and occasionally examining sensors. Self-emptying models reduce the frequency of dustbin emptying.

Q6: Can automatic hoovers deal with pet hair efficiently?A: Yes, numerous automatic hoovers are specifically designed for pet owners and are highly effective at getting pet hair. Try to find models with features like tangle-free brushes and strong suction, typically marketed as "pet hair" models.

Q7: What takes place if an automatic hoover gets stuck?A: Modern automatic hoovers are equipped with challenge sensing units and navigation systems to minimize getting stuck. Nevertheless, they might sometimes get stuck on cables, loose carpets, or in tight spaces. The majority of designs will stop and indicate if they are stuck, typically via an app notification.

Q8: Can I control an automatic hoover from another location?A: Many mid-range and high-end designs come with smartphone app connection, permitting remote control, scheduling, monitoring cleaning status, and accessing functions like zone cleaning and no-go zones.

Q10: Can automatic hoovers clean in the dark?A: Yes, the majority of automatic hoovers can clean in low light conditions or perhaps darkness. They depend on their sensors and navigation systems, which are typically not dependent on ambient light for fundamental operation. Models with visual navigation might carry out optimally in adequate lighting, but are normally created to function in normal family lighting conditions.
